Quote from: aura of foreboding on July 22, 2019, 02:03:46 PM
Interesting to see so much Universal Monster merchandise in the top 10% of sales.  It bodes well.

I think so as well. It also bodes well that much of the stuff they have previously had is sold out so it doesn't even show up (not sitting on inventory would seem to incentivize making more and taking some risks). I think they might even be surprised how well those Super Soakies will sell. I think those have some pretty broad appeal. I have heard them say multiple times how surprised they were by how popular some of the monster stuff has been (the Super Buckets and the overwhelming attendance at last years Boodega being among them). I feel somewhat of a mini renaissance with the Universal Monsters, even among a much younger crowd. Creature is a big hit among that crowd but so are some of the others. I was talking to a 25 year old (very normal and well adjusted) girl the other day and she was a huge Frankenstein fan. Collected like crazy. So, there is hope this will continue.
